A study by the University of Plymouth found inconsistent and misleading advice from popular password meters, potentially putting users at risk. The research tested 16 password meters and found that some would not flag weak passwords, such as 'abc123' or 'qwertyuiop', despite being among the worst passwords of 2019.

A recent study found that exercising while using antibacterial mouthwash can significantly reduce the benefits of exercise on lowering blood pressure. The researchers discovered that oral bacteria play a crucial role in the production of nitrite, a molecule that enhances nitric oxide production and helps maintain widened blood vessels....

A new study finds that restricting inshore potting for crab and lobster within marine protected areas generates a win-win for both fishermen and the environment. Crab caught in low-potting areas were found to be heavier than those caught in areas with medium-high potting levels or unfished control areas.
A new study published in Health & Place suggests that being able to see greenery from one's home is linked to lower frequencies and strengths of craving for alcohol, cigarettes, and harmful foods. Researchers found that access to a garden or allotment and residential views with over 25% greenspace were associated with reduced cravings.

A new study by the University of Plymouth found that biodegradable plastic bags remained functional as carrier bags for over three years when exposed to air, soil, and sea. The compostable bag completely disappeared after just three months in a marine environment, while others continued to show signs of deterioration but remained intact.

Macrophages play a vital role in controlling the processes of nerve repair following damage by secreting repulsive cues. The interaction between Slit3 and Robo1 allows for the migration of Schwann cells and regrowing nerve projections, enabling successful regeneration and recovery of nerve function.
